The upcoming Marvel movie, “The Fantastic Four,” is still in the early stages of production, but a new map of New York City in the Marvel Cinematic Universe (MCU) provides an engaging sneak peek into the film’s background. Notably, the Baxter Building, previously showcased in Spider-Man: No Way Home, now includes a launch pad named “Excelsior” as a tribute to Stan Lee. The map further unveils the “Yancy Street Neighborhood” and confirms the existence of the “FF Clean Energy Complex” on Governor’s Island. Most notably, it reveals “Subterranea,” which comic enthusiasts will remember as Mole Man’s lair and the home to various subterranean creatures. This disclosure implies that the film may introduce a new and formidable villain into the MCU.

Multiple images have emerged showcasing a captivating map of New York City from Marvel’s The Fantastic Four movie, handed out to fans in Hall H as a token for their ticket purchase to demonstrate support for the film. This unique memento pinpoints various notable spots from the universe where the characters of The Fantastic Four: First Steps reside on an alternate Earth. The map is brimming with enticing locations, and upon closer inspection, it seems to hint at the presence of an additional villain, lending credence to whispers that the MCU’s Fantastic Four will encounter more enemies than just Galactus. Of particular interest, a location on the map, positioned right beside the Statue of Liberty, suggests the existence of Subterranea within this Manhattan version. Furthermore, entrances to Subterranea are scattered throughout the map, including near the Baxter Building. In Marvel comic book lore, Subterranea is the realm of Harvey Elder’s Mole Man, as well as his Moloids and various subterranean creatures living deep beneath the Earth. The appearance of Subterranea strongly suggests that Mole Man, one of The Fantastic Four’s most infamous adversaries long rumored to appear in the film, may be set to make his MCU debut in The Fantastic Four: First Steps, potentially taking on a significant role or even a brief appearance.

There have been rumors that Paul Walter Hauser could play the role of Mole Man in the upcoming Fantastic Four film, possibly acting as the initial adversary. However, Marvel Studios has not officially confirmed this yet. Since Hauser’s casting was announced in May, there has been growing excitement about the possibility of Mole Man being part of the production. The addition of Hauser, along with other actors whose roles are undisclosed, fuels speculation that some of The Fantastic Four’s most notorious villains might make an appearance. However, it’s possible that Mole Man and other villains could be featured in a flashback scene. Although Hauser has not revealed his exact role, he intends to delve into the comics to prepare for his part in the upcoming project. The presence of Subterranea on the map is a strong indication that Mole Man could be joining the cast, leaving fans eagerly anticipating an extended guest appearance.

Marvel Studios has announced the star-studded cast for “The Fantastic Four: First Steps.” Pedro Pascal takes on Reed Richards/Mister Fantastic, Joseph Quinn becomes Johnny Storm/Human Torch, Vanessa Kirby is Sue Storm/Invisible Woman, and Ebon Moss-Bachrach portrays Ben Grimm/The Thing. Joining them are Ralph Ineson as the menacing villain Galactus, Julia Garner as Shalla-Bal/Silver Surfer, and Paul Walter Hauser, Natasha Lyonne, and John Malkovich in unspecified roles. The storyline focuses on Galactus and Silver Surfer’s intent to destroy Earth. Matt Shakman, famed for “WandaVision,” partners with Cam Squires from “WandaVison” and Josh Friedman, a co-writer of “Avatar: The Way of Water,” on the script. Eric Pearson, writer of “Black Widow,” was recently recruited to fine-tune the screenplay.
